Colusa, CA (January 12, 2025) – A three-vehicle collision with injuries occurred on Friday evening on I-5 S near the Maxwell off-ramp in Colusa County. Emergency responders quickly arrived at the scene to assist those involved.

The incident, reported at approximately 5:35 PM, involved a silver Pontiac, a blue sports vehicle, and a blue sedan. Initial reports indicated that one vehicle had flipped and two vehicles were blocking the #2 lane. Fire crews and law enforcement worked together to extract an individual from the blue vehicle while managing the scene to restore traffic flow.

Tow trucks, including High Tech Towing, Sanders Towing, and Selovers Towing, were dispatched to clear the damaged vehicles and debris. Traffic disruptions were significant, but the roadway was eventually cleared by 6:50 PM. The California Highway Patrol (CHP) later updated the incident status to reflect minor injuries among the parties involved.

CHP continues to investigate the circumstances surrounding the collision, including potential contributing factors such as driver behavior and road conditions.
